Pre-Operative Guidelines

Prior to your Hernia surgical procedure, it is necessary to follow these pre-operative directions to make sure an effective treatment and recuperation.

First and foremost, see to it to quit consuming or consuming alcohol anything after twelve o'clock at night the evening prior to your surgical treatment. This consists of water, gum tissue, and also mints. It's vital to have an empty stomach to stop any issues throughout the surgical procedure.

Furthermore, you'll need to arrange for somebody to drive you home after the procedure, as you won't be able to drive yourself because of the effects of anesthesia.

Make sure to use loosened, comfortable clothes on the day of your surgery, and leave any kind of beneficial jewelry or devices in the house.

Finally, adhere to any type of certain instructions provided to you by your doctor relating to medication, showering, and any other preparations.

Post-Operative Care Tips

After your Hernia surgical treatment, it is very important to comply with these post-operative care suggestions for a smooth recuperation:

1. Rest: Rest is essential in the recovery process. Avoid arduous tasks and raising heavy items for the first couple of weeks after surgical treatment.

2. Keep the cut tidy and completely dry: Follow your doctor's directions for injury treatment. Keep the laceration site tidy and dry to prevent infection.

3. Manage pain and pain: Take suggested pain medicine as routed. Using ice packs to the laceration area can also help reduce swelling and pain.

4. Comply with a healthy and balanced diet: Eating healthy dishes can help in the recovery process. Concentrate on foods that are high in protein and fiber to advertise tissue repair and protect against bowel irregularity.
